Applications

As a magnet school, we require applications for enrollment. Any student who resides in Tyler or the surrounding area without an Early College can attend.

Applications open each year to students currently in the 8th or 9th grade.

Transportation

Transportation is provided for students residing in the Tyler ISD zoned area.

A shuttle is provided from ECHS to TJC each morning and afternoon.

TJC Partnership

We have a partnership between Tyler ISD and TJC that allows our students to simultaneously obtain their high school diploma and an associate degree from TJC. Our students can earn up to 60 college credits at no cost. Students are also able to participate in all TJC events and have use of their facilities.

Complete the TJC Promise Program and receive tuition and fees for up to two years through a combination of federal grants, TJC Scholarships, and the TJC Promise.
